アルバとロスThis time, instead of No. 7 yeast, Kaze no Mori used a special flower yeast called "Yamanokami Yeast" for the first time. This sake is a charity sake to support the recovery of the brewery that was damaged by the Noto Peninsula Earthquake in 2024. The fragrance is gorgeous, with a slight gaseous sensation, and a refined sweetness and acidity that are typical of Kaze no Mori. Bottled type

アルバとロスAkita Tour Ginjo Series As expected from Shinmasa, the fresh acidity, sweetness and umami are well balanced, and the light alcohol content makes it easy to drink. Rice used: Koudou Shinko Rice polishing ratio: 55/60 Yeast used: Kyokai No. 6 Alcohol content: 13%. Screw-in stopper with lid.

アルバとロスSpeaking of spring, this is what I'm talking about. Red yeast ooze has accumulated up to the mouth, open it slowly so it doesn't blow out in the second fermentation. Sake level is -55, super sweet, acidity is 3.3, and alcohol level is 11 degrees, so it is easy to drink ◎. Perforated stopper type

アルバとロスAkita Touriginjo Series Gentle sweetness, low acidity Rice:Akita Sake Komachi Rice polishing ratio: 35 Yeast used: In-house yeast Alcohol percentage: 15.9 Sake degree: -2.7 Acidity: 1.2, Amino acidity: 0.8 Screw stopper type

アルバとロスAkita Tour Ginjo Series Gorgeous aroma, light and with a nice bitterness. Rice used: Undisclosed Rice polishing ratio: 55 Yeast used: In-house cultivated yeast Alcohol level: 16% Sake meter: +2.5 Acidity: 1.5, Amino acidity: 0.7 Screw stopper type

アルバとロスAkita Tour Ginjo Series Light sweetness and refreshing acidity Rice used: Ippozumi Polishing ratio: 50 Yeast used: Akita-style flower yeast AK-1 Alcohol percentage: 15.2 degrees Sake degree: ±0 Acidity: 2.0, Amino acidity: 0.7 Screw stopper type
